Virtana: Getting to grips with Hybrid Clouds
Digital Leaders focus more strongly on using advanced automation and orchestration as well as intelligent assisted operations for agility and flexibility, while also proactively managing performance and cost.
Most companies are embracing cloud, but very few are transitioning completely to public cloud. Even the most digitally advanced companies have a strong on-premises preference, but they are the most open to using cloud alongside this. Almost all workloads — with suitable optimization — are now capable of running in the public cloud.
However, most companies still prefer to keep many workloads on-premises or deploy them in a hybrid cloud approach for performance, security, or privacy reasons.
